Pose or Purpose? 

Pose is showing others what we pretend to be & what they want us to become.
Purpose is showing your own self what you are & what you want to become.

Have you ever felt as if you are living life the way others want you to be or the way others tell is the only way to live life. We all feel this way sometime or the other. This is a feeling sent by universe to change your direction. But we feel this as a common thing and ignore it. Once this message dissolves in our brain, again we involve ourselves in worldly matters.

How artificial our thoughts have become in this world. Only for the sake of surviving, we have embraced sensual pleasures, possessions, fake identity, false security and masked intentions. We have given up our purpose of living. In the name of technology our own spiritual powers have been stolen. We have become servants of technology. Our desires tripled and their bank balances too. Everyone is out there to show others how happy and rich they are, when in fact they are so poor that they want others’ attention to feel rich. Whenever I see people here spending thousands of rupees for the name sake, but not even a rupee for human sake, I feel as if I am living in hell. It’s about time to make this place a heaven. And it starts with our brain.

Our purpose is to seek the ultimate truth and seek asylum of the very nature. There are many paths through which we can reach the truth, but there is only one ultimate truth. But instead, what we do is mask lie with the name of truth (pose) and accept it as to be the truth. We destroy our own house i.e., our nature and build artificial houses in our brain to justify it. The psychology of humans is at the cross roads now. Even though we have kept our foot on the road of lie, the source of life i.e., truth is still sending us messages through nature. We compare that unique message with mundane world and ignore that message. It’s time to notice that message. Once our thoughts in brain becomes pure, everything starts becoming pure.

There is still time. Pose is still a pose and before that pose becomes the only purpose, we have to escape from this artificial prison we have created in our brain. Come out. Happiness and bliss have always been here. They were just hiding behind the our selfish intents and human-less actions. Isn’t the feeling of being alive is the ultimate rather than desiring for worldly pleasures. Once think upon it.

Hold the hand of faith and seek for ultimate truth. This journey is full of eternal bliss and happiness. It is up to you, Pose or Purpose? Thanks for reading. Have a great sunday.
